Transaction 067f24f9669b939d2673229465fd9e4bb415b3cef4f8713af2e631951231ebba

2 Input
2 Outputs
  • 067f24f9669b939d2673229465fd9e4bb415b3cef4f8713af2e631951231ebba:0
  • value  2573048
    address  1E2KecsQn72pTRAezfQZYygjc591ZrcjD2
  • 067f24f9669b939d2673229465fd9e4bb415b3cef4f8713af2e631951231ebba:1
  • value  38300000
    address  1MQdusKcjNy8wtNGXodQjS3eugc7NCpvJU